Anirban Roychowdhury has authored 25 papers that have received a total of 322 indexed citations.
This includes 16 papers in Molecular Biology, 6 papers in Epidemiology and 6 papers in Cancer Research. The topics of these papers are Cervical Cancer and HPV Research (6 papers), Cancer-related molecular mechanisms research (5 papers) and Epigenetics and DNA Methylation (4 papers). Anirban Roychowdhury is often cited by papers focused on Cervical Cancer and HPV Research (6 papers), Cancer-related molecular mechanisms research (5 papers) and Epigenetics and DNA Methylation (4 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in India, United States and France. Anirban Roychowdhury's co-authors include Chinmay Kumar Panda, Susanta Roychoudhury, Anup Roy, Pijush K. Das and Ranajit Kumar Mondal and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Biochemical Journal and Gene.
